'Forced me to give false statement': Chhattisgarh 'human trafficking' victim accuses Bajrang Dal of 'coercion'; backs arrested Kerala nuns
Chhattisgarh alleged human trafficking incident

NEW DELHI: A sufferer of an alleged human trafficking and forceful conversion, wherein 3, together with two nuns from Kerala, were arrested in Chhattisgarhhas alleged she was once “coerced and assaulted” via Bajrang Dal activists to present a false commentary, a rate denied via the right-wing outfit.The girl, 21, additional claimed that her police commentary was once additionally now not recorded correctly, and added that her circle of relatives has been following Christianity for the remaining four-five years.Additionally Learn: Kerala rises in protest over nuns’ arrest in ChhattisgarhHer folks, too, declared that the arrested individuals arrested had been blameless. They referred to as for the trio to be launched from prison.“I used to be going to Agra with the nuns with the consent of my folks. From there, we had been about to visit Bhopal the place we had been to be given paintings at a Christian medical institution. We had been promised Rs 10,000 wage per thirty days together with meals, garments and lodging,” the girl recalled to information company PTI.“The nuns, whom I had by no means met prior to, arrived a couple of hours later there. In the meantime, we had been faced via an individual. Later, different individuals from Bajrang Dal joined him. They began threatening, abusing and assaulting us,” she added.Additionally Learn: Kerala nuns incident tarnished India’s symbol, says Orthodox synodThe Govt Railway Police (GRP), she alleged, took her to a railway police station, the place she was once slapped via a girl, Jyoti Sharma, who recognized herself as a right-wing activist.“Sharma slapped me and threatened me to switch my commentary. She informed me to mention I used to be taken via power. She threatened that if I did not, my brother can be jailed and crushed up. The GRP didn’t take my precise commentary and had been writing issues I by no means stated. After I attempted to talk, they informed me to be quiet and requested if I sought after to move house,” she mentioned.The girl described Sukhman Mandavi, who was once arrested together with the nuns, as a “brother to me.”On the other hand, Bajrang Dal Durg unit convener Ravi Nigam denied all of the allegations.“We’ve neither threatened nor crushed someone. There are CCTV cameras put in on the railway station, the reality will pop out via them,” Nigam famous.Nuns Preethi Mary and Vandana Francis, together with Mandavi had been arrested via the GRP at Chhattisgarh’s Durg railway station on July 25 following a criticism via a neighborhood Bajrang Dal functionary, who accused them of “forcibly changing” 3 ladies from the tribal-dominated Narayanpur district and trafficking them.
